学完 golang 学什么
继续深入 golang 相关领域
学完 golang 后,你可以继续深入 golang 的相关领域,如并发编程、网络编程等。并发编程是 golang 的一大特色,通过 goroutine 和 channel 等机制,能够轻松实现高效的并发处理。你可以学习如何利用 goroutine 进行异步编程,提高程序的性能和响应速度。网络编程方面,golang 提供了丰富的网络库,如 net/http、net/rpc 等,方便开发者构建网络服务和客户端应用。
学习其他编程语言
除了继续深入 golang 领域,学习其他编程语言也是一个不错的选择。,你可以学习 Python,它具有简洁的语法和丰富的库,在数据科学、机器学习等领域广泛应用。Python 的语法简洁易懂,能够快速实现原型开发和数据分析任务。学习 JavaScript 也是一个不错的选择,它是前端开发的主流语言,掌握 JavaScript 可以帮助你构建交互式的 Web 应用。JavaScript 的灵活性使其在前端开发中具有广泛的应用场景。
涉足后端开发其他技术
学完 golang 后,你还可以涉足后端开发的其他技术,如数据库、缓存等。数据库是后端开发中不可或缺的一部分,你可以学习 MySQL、PostgreSQL 等关系型数据库,或者 Redis、MongoDB 等非关系型数据库。了解不同数据库的特点和使用场景,能够更好地满足项目的需求。可以提高系统的性能,你可以学习如何使用 Redis 等缓存技术,减少数据库的访问次数,提高响应速度。
探索云原生技术
随着云原生技术的兴起,学完 golang 后,你也可以探索云原生技术领域。容器技术如 Docker 能够实现应用的隔离和快速部署,golang 与 Docker 结合可以构建高效的容器化应用。微服务架构是云原生的重要组成部分,golang 适合构建微服务,能够实现服务的独立部署和扩展。
提升系统架构能力
学完 golang 后,你可以通过学习系统架构相关知识来提升自己的能力。了解分布式系统、高可用架构等方面的知识,能够更好地设计和实现复杂的系统。分布式系统可以将应用分布在多个节点上,提高系统的吞吐量和可用性。高可用架构则能够保证系统在出现故障时仍然能够正常运行。
学完 golang 后,你可以继续深入 golang 相关领域,学习其他编程语言,涉足后端开发其他技术,探索云原生技术,以及提升系统架构能力。这些领域的学习将帮助你在软件开发领域取得更大的成就。
从文中提炼的问题: 1. 学完 golang 后继续深入 golang 相关领域有哪些? 2. 学习其他编程语言对学完 golang 的人有什么帮助? 3. 涉足后端开发其他技术包括哪些方面? 4. 探索云原生技术与 golang 结合有哪些优势?